“American Idol” Winner Noah Thompson Shares What He Wants To Do Next

American Idol / YouTube

Noah Thompson was working construction in Kentucky when he learned that his friend, Arthur, signed him up to audition for American Idol without telling him. Thompson went to the audition and won the judges over with his talent.

In that moment, Thompson never could have imagined that he’d eventually be named the winner of American Idol.

Thompson took home the winning title on Sunday (May 22), with fellow country singer HunterGirl coming in second place. While speaking with USA Today, Thompson said he was shocked about his win:

Honestly, dude, I was just kind of numb. It blew me away. I just didn’t know how to feel. Anybody could have won this show, you know what I mean? I just didn’t think that it was me.”

Judge Luke Bryan said he believes people voted for Thompson to win because he was so “unassuming.” As Bryan told PEOPLE after the finale:

He just came in as the underdog…the unassuming guy that he didn’t see it coming, America didn’t see it coming. And I think, you know, we’ve seen it in twenty years where those type people, really — American pulls for them, responds to them. And it always tells me that at the end of the day, being a good, humble, kind person wins.”

So what’s next for Thompson now that he’s the newly crowned winner of American Idol? He shared his plans in an interview with Good Morning America.

Thompson says he wants to return to his hometown of Louisa, Kentucky to “just take it all in” after his big win:

I want to see my family and just kind of let this settle in, you know what I mean?” he said. “It’s going to be wild. I’m going to try to just stick to, you know, staying in the house for a little bit.”

Thompson and his girlfriend, Angel, share a one-year-old son named Walker. He told Music Mayhem he hopes he’ll be able to make his son proud:

For me, I remember the way I looked at my dad as a kid, I thought he was a rockstar, you know what I mean?” Thompson said. “So, I think the coolest thing for me, out of this whole thing, is by the time Walker is at that age where he can look at all this and be like, ‘That’s my dad.’ And that’ll be a really proud thing for him. So for me, I think that’s the coolest thing out of this whole process.”
